hasExternalOutput

public boolean hasExternalOutput()
Description copied from class: AbstractDevice
Specifies whether this device has external (implicit) output or not. Returns false by default.

Return false if the device has no border effects. Most of input and processing devices are in this case.

Return true if the device has border effects, such as graphical feedback, or control of some external value. Examples of devices with external output are application-interfacing devices and all user feedback devices.

This method can be used by the editor for the device's graphical representation. However there is at now no clear definition of what is external output.

open

public Processor open(OpenContext context)
Description copied from class: AbstractDevice
Subclass this method if you want to specialize data processing, or if you want to perform some initializations before running the device.

By default, open() does nothing and returns the device itself as the Processor (or null if it is not openable): AbstractDevice implements both Device and Processor interfaces, so that you can add processing code directly into the device.

If you want to add specialization features, subclass this method to return a specific processor implementation depending on your device configuration.

Example :

public Processor getProcessor() { if (super.open() == null) return null; // Select the right processor if (in2.isValid()) { return new twoParamProcessor(in1, in2, out); else return new oneParamProcessor(in1, out); }

In this method, you may also perform all necessary pre-running initialization. If initialization fails, return null even if isOpenable() returns true.

In all cases, return null if isOpenable() returns false.

init

public void init()
Description copied from class: AbstractDevice
Initializes device's output values.

Subclass init() and update() methods if you want the device to process the data itself. Otherwise, subclass getProcessor() method to use extern processors. By default, this method calls update(). Subclass this method if you'd like to make a specific initialization routine.
